THERMOSTAT ADJUSTMENTS
The temperature in your new oven has been set cor-
rectly at the factory, so be sure to follow the recipe
temperatures and times the first few times you bake in
your new oven.
We do not recommend the use of inexpensive thermom-
eters, such as those found in the grocery store, to
readjust the temperature setting of your new oven.
These thermometers can vary by 20° - 40°F. Your oven
has been preset to maximize cooking efficiency.
if you think the oven should be hotter or cooler, you can
adjust it yourself. To decide how much to change the
temperature, set the oven temperature 25°F higher or
lower than the temperature in your recipe, then bake.
The results of this "test" should give you an idea of how
much the temperature should be changed.
To adjust knob:
1. Turn OVEN SET KNOB to OFF and remove the knob
by pulling straight off.
2. Look at the back of the knob. The arrow pointing to
the center of the bottom screw indicates the original
factory setting.
3. Use a screwdriver to loosen the two screws about 2
turns each.
4. Hold theknob handle(Aon illustration)while turningthe
disk (Bon illustration)inthedeslreddirectionto increase
or decrease the temperature. (See illustration_low for
"Self-Clean Thermostat".) Asyou turn, you should be
able to hear clicks and feel notches or teeth. Each
click or notch Is 15°F. You can turn up to 2 clicks cr
notches in either direction.
5. When you reach the desired adjustment, retighten
both screws.
